Dead Coin Battery

A dead battery is the main cause of your 500 key fob being inoperative. Modern key fobs only have an operating range that is limited and must be within a few inches of the vehicle to work. If you are far from your vehicle, and you press the keyfob button it won't respond and display the message "Key Fob Not Detected".

If this happens, simply replace the coin cell battery (Part number CR2032) with a fresh one from a trusted brand such as Panasonic, Duracell, or Energizer. They can be found in the local hardware store or online.

You can test the coin-cell battery by pressing the buttons while standing close to your fiat punto remote key price 500. The car will flash its parking lights, and the key fob should work the lock and unlock switches.

If your fob's key isn't working even after replacing the battery, it may be water damage which has prevented it from interacting with the module in your vehicle. Water damage can happen in many ways, such as simply splashing or submerging the key fob into saltwater at the beach. If you suspect that your fob was exposed to water, put it in a dry rice bag to draw the moisture out. If that doesn't work, your fob is likely to require reprogramming by a professional auto locksmith or the dealer.

Water Damage

Damage to the water supply can occur if you immerse the fob into the ocean or wash it in a machine. Saltwater can cause the circuit board to short and eventually fail. If you get the fob wet, it's not an ideal choice however, if you drop it into the water in a cup or don't remember to remove it from your pants pocket prior to running the washer and you don't have a chance, don't give in.

Take the battery off first. Before replacing the battery clean the electronic chip with isopropyl, or a similar product. Test the fob next to verify if it's functioning. If the key isn't working it could need to be changed. This is usually handled by a dealer or professional auto locksmith.

Interference

In addition to a dead battery on a coin the key fob could not be able to transmit or receive an signal due to interference. This can occur when the key fob is in close proximity to a radio transmitter like a cellphone or radar detector. The key fob might not function because of a weak connection to the buttons, water damage or damage to the internal chips.

If the key fob has stopped working one day without notice, or after trying every option at home to resolve it e.g. replacing the battery, reprogramming it and using the spare key fob, you could have a faulty receiver module on your 500. The receiver module is located under the dash and picks up the radio frequency signals from the key fob. It converts them to electronic commands that the vehicle interprets.

Luckily, there is an easy way to reset every single system on board in your 500 and include the key fob. Disconnect the battery of 12 volts for about 15 minutes by removing the negative cable first then the positive cable. Then, reconnect the battery. This will eliminate any remaining electricity, and allow you to restart the computer in your car. This will help you get your key fob working again.
